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

Choinka, pętla while

Ostatnio zmodyfikowano 2015-11-17 12:12
Autor Wiadomość
przemekkk
Temat założony przez niniejszego użytkownika
» 2015-11-17 11:53:50
C/C++
int main()
{
    int i, j, a;
    printf( "podaj wysokosc drzewka \n" );
    scanf( "%d", & a );
    i = 0;
    j = 0;
    while( i < a )
    {
        printf( "%*c", a - i, ' ' );
        while( j <= i )
             j++;
       
        printf( " *" );
        putchar( '\n' );
        i++;
    }
    printf( "%*c*\n", a + 1, ' ' );
    getchar();
    getchar();
    return 0;
}

Zrobiłem tak, i teraz wyświetla mi połowę drzewka.
P-140279
carlosmay
» 2015-11-17 11:59:25
Prawie. Zmienna 'j' powinna być zerowana przed każdym uruchomieniem wewnętrznej pętli
C/C++
j = 0;
while( j <= i ) {
    printf( " *" );
    j++;
}
P-140280
przemekkk
Temat założony przez niniejszego użytkownika
» 2015-11-17 12:04:51
Jest ok. Dzięki wielkie. Zamiast j=0; wstawiłem j+0;
A istnieje możliwość aby w pustych miejscach pojawiała się litera "o", jako bombka?
P-140281
carlosmay
» 2015-11-17 12:12:01
Programowanie ogranicza inwencja twórcza i wiedza.
P-140282
1 « 2 »
Poprzednia strona Strona 2 z 2